What Is a Metric Scale Rowing Boat PDF?
A metric scale rowing boat PDF is a digital file containing detailed boat building plans that use the metric system for all measurements. These plans typically include:
- Blueprints and diagrams
- Material lists and specifications
- Step-by-step assembly instructions
- Cutting templates and component details
Having the plans in PDF format allows easy access, printing, and zooming in for minute details, making the construction process straightforward and efficient. The use of metric measurements (millimeters, centimeters, meters) caters particularly well to builders in countries that utilize the metric system or those who prefer it over imperial measurements.

How to Use a Metric Scale Rowing Boat PDF Plan Effectively
Having a detailed PDF plan is only half the battle; knowing how to use it effectively is essential. Here are some expert tips for utilizing metric scale rowing boat plans:
1. Familiarize Yourself with the Plan
Before starting, thoroughly review all sections of the PDF, including diagrams, instructions, and materials. Pay attention to the metric measurements and conversion notes if any.
2. Prepare Your Workspace and Tools
Set up a clean, spacious area with proper lighting. Ensure you have metric measuring tools such as a tape measure, ruler, and square for accurate cuts.
3. Print Templates at Actual Size
Many plans offer printable templates. Use a printer that can handle the size or tile print across sheets, then carefully tape pieces together to maintain scale.
4. Double-Check Measurements
Always measure twice before cutting. The metric system’s decimal nature makes it easier, but mistakes can still happen.
5. Follow Step-by-Step
Work sequentially through the instructions. Skipping steps can cause alignment and structural issues later.
6. Use Quality Materials
Adhering to the materials list ensures your boat’s durability and performance. The plans often specify ideal wood types and fasteners based on strength and weight.
7. Ask for Help if Needed
Boat building communities and forums can be invaluable if you encounter challenges or want advice on modifications.
Common Challenges When Working with Metric Scale Rowing Boat PDF Plans
While metric plans simplify many aspects, there are some common challenges you should be aware of:
Interpreting Complex Diagrams
Sometimes the blueprints can be intricate, especially for beginners. Taking time to study them and comparing views (top, side, cross-section) can clarify details.
Scaling and Printing Issues
Ensuring your printed templates are at true scale can be tricky. Use test measurements and calibrate your printer settings carefully.
Material Availability
Some specified materials may not be readily available locally. Seek equivalent substitutes that match strength and weather resistance.
Skill Level Requirements
Some plans assume intermediate woodworking skills. Beginners should consider seeking additional tutorials on boat-building basics.
Tips for Enhancing Your Rowing Boat Build
- Waterproofing: Apply marine-grade varnish or epoxy coatings to protect the wood.
- Seating Comfort: Use cushioned seats or add ergonomic supports.
- Weight Optimization: Select lightweight materials without compromising strength for easier rowing.
- Customization: Modify plans to suit storage needs, such as adding compartments or oarlocks.
- Safety Features: Incorporate flotation chambers or attach safety lines.
